What Should You Consider Before Buying an Amplifier for Your Computer?

When considering the purchase of an amplifier for your computer, several key factors can significantly impact your decision:

  • Purpose and Use Case: Determine whether you need the amplifier for casual listening, gaming, or professional audio work. Different applications may require varying levels of power, features, and sound quality.

  • Power Output: Look for an amplifier that can provide enough power to drive your speakers effectively. Consider the wattage and ensure it matches your speakers’ ratings.

  • Impedance Compatibility: Ensure the amplifier’s impedance matches that of your speakers. Most consumer-level speakers operate at 4, 6, or 8 ohms. Mismatched impedance can lead to poor performance and potential damage.

  • Audio Quality: Check the amplifier’s specifications and reviews for sound quality. Look for features like low total harmonic distortion (THD) and a high signal-to-noise ratio (SNR).

  • Connectivity Options: Consider the types of inputs you need. USB, RCA, Bluetooth, and optical inputs can affect usability and integration with your existing setup.

  • Form Factor and Aesthetics: Depending on your workspace, choose an amplifier that fits well and complements your computer setup, whether you prefer a compact model or a more traditional larger unit.

  • Budget: Set a budget that aligns with your audio needs. There are amplifiers available across a broad price range, so identify features that are essential for your purposes.

How Do Different Speaker Types Affect Amplifier Choice?

Different speaker types can significantly influence the choice of amplifier for a computer setup.

  • Passive Speakers: These speakers require an external amplifier to power them, making the choice of amplifier crucial for optimal sound quality.
  • Active Speakers: Active speakers have built-in amplifiers, so they can directly connect to a computer without needing an external amplifier.
  • Bookshelf Speakers: Typically passive, these speakers are popular for home audio and require a dedicated amplifier that matches their power requirements for the best performance.
  • Studio Monitors: These are often active speakers designed for precision sound, and while they don’t need an external amplifier, choosing a compatible audio interface can enhance their performance.
  • Soundbars: Generally designed for TVs, soundbars can be used with computers and often include built-in amplification, simplifying the setup.

Passive speakers demand a suitable amplifier that matches their impedance and power handling, ensuring that the audio output is clear and without distortion. The amplifier’s wattage should ideally exceed the speaker’s rating to prevent clipping at higher volumes.

Active speakers come with their own amplification, making them a convenient choice for computer users who prefer a plug-and-play experience. When selecting active speakers, it’s essential to consider their input compatibility and sound quality.

Bookshelf speakers, being compact and versatile, often work best with a dedicated amplifier that can deliver enough power without compromising sound quality. This ensures a balanced audio experience, especially in smaller spaces.

Studio monitors are designed for accurate sound reproduction, and while they typically have built-in amplification, pairing them with a high-quality audio interface can further enhance their capabilities, particularly for music production or critical listening.

Soundbars, although primarily created for television use, can efficiently serve as computer speakers due to their simple setup and built-in amplifiers. They usually come with various connectivity options, allowing easy integration with computer systems.

How Can You Properly Connect Your Amplifier to a Computer?

To connect an amplifier to your computer effectively, follow these steps:

  1. Select the Right Cable: Most amplifiers accept RCA or 3.5mm auxiliary (aux) inputs. Use an RCA cable if your amplifier has RCA inputs, or a 3.5mm aux cable for a direct connection.

  2. Determine the Output Options: Check your computer’s audio output options. Many PCs and laptops have a 3.5mm headphone jack, while some might offer optical or USB outputs. If you’re using USB, ensure the amplifier supports digital inputs.

  3. Connect Using the Appropriate Port:
    – For an RCA connection: Plug the RCA ends into the amplifier’s input and the other end into the headphone jack of your computer using a 3.5mm to RCA adapter if necessary.
    – For a direct aux connection: Simply plug the 3.5mm end into the headphone jack and the other into the amplifier.

  4. Set Up the Amplifier: Turn on the amplifier and adjust the volume to a low level to prevent sudden loud sound.

  5. Configure Computer Audio Settings: On your computer, go to audio settings to ensure the correct output device is selected and adjust the volume accordingly.

  6. Test the Sound: Play audio to test the connection and make adjustments to the amplifier settings for optimal sound quality.

Using these steps, you can efficiently connect your amplifier to enjoy enhanced audio from your computer.
